Emerging Trends and Technological Disruptions

The marine electric vehicle sector is poised for substantial growth, with a projected Compound Annual Growth Rate (CAGR) of approximately 12.21% over the forecast period. This expansion is fueled by advancements in battery technology, leading to increased energy density and faster charging capabilities. Innovations in electric propulsion systems are enhancing efficiency and reducing maintenance requirements. Furthermore, the integration of artificial intelligence and advanced connectivity is paving the way for smarter, more autonomous vessels. The increasing focus on environmental regulations and the drive for decarbonization across all industries are significant catalysts, compelling a shift away from traditional fossil-fuel-powered marine craft. Digitalization of maritime operations, including predictive maintenance and optimized route planning, further underpins this sustainable revolution.


High-Growth Segments of Tomorrow

The market's future expansion will be significantly driven by specific segments. Battery Electric Vehicles are expected to dominate as technology matures and infrastructure develops. Within platform types, the On-water segment will see robust growth, encompassing a wide range of applications. Craft applications such as Leisure Tourist Surface Boats are anticipated to experience a surge in demand due to growing eco-tourism trends and a desire for quieter, more environmentally friendly recreational experiences. Autonomous Underwater Vehicles (AUVs) are also positioned for significant growth, driven by increasing applications in offshore exploration, marine research, and defense. Hybrid Electric and Plug-in Hybrid Electric variants will continue to play a crucial role in bridging the gap for applications requiring extended range or operational flexibility.


Pioneers and Innovators

The vanguard of this evolving market includes a dynamic mix of established players and agile innovators. Companies such as Boesch Motorboote AG, Torqeedo GmBH, and Duffy Electric Boat are setting new benchmarks in performance and design for surface vessels. In the realm of advanced battery solutions, Electrovaya, Corvus Energy, and Saft are critical enablers of longer range and faster charging. Triton Submarines is at the forefront of underwater electric mobility. Furthermore, industry giants like Wärtsilä- and Boeing are exploring and investing in electrification for larger marine applications, signaling a broader industry commitment. Andaman Boatyard represents emerging regional innovation in shipbuilding.


Future Regional Dynamics

North America, particularly the United States and Canada, is expected to lead the adoption curve due to strong environmental policies and significant investment in green technologies. Europe, with countries like Germany and France, is a key region for innovation and regulatory advancement, fostering substantial growth across all segments. The Asia Pacific region, especially China and ASEAN nations, presents immense untapped potential with a growing focus on sustainable shipping and increasing disposable incomes driving leisure marine demand. Other regions like South America, the Middle East & Africa will also witness increasing adoption as the cost-effectiveness and environmental benefits of electric marine solutions become more apparent.
